£70m more vouchers offered for energy efficiency

DECC is providing another £70 million to fund energy efficiency improvements in households across England and Wales, writes Energy Live News.

It is the third release from the Green Deal Home Improvement Fund (GDHIF) and will be open to new applicants from midday on 16th March.

Householders can apply for funding worth up to £5,600 in the form of vouchers to help with the cost of installing energy-saving measures such as solid wall insulation, double glazing, boilers and cavity wall insulation.

Under the scheme, domestic energy customers will be able to receive:

  • up to £3,750 for installing solid wall insulation;
  • and/or up to £1,250 for installing two measures from an approved list;
  • up to £100 refunded for their Green Deal Assessment;
  • up to £500 more if applying within 12 months of buying a new home.
